About G3D Mark
G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

Radeon HD 5600/5700
The Radeon HD 5600/5700 is manufactured by AMD. It was released in December 14 2010. It features the TeraScale 3 architecture. The boost clock speed is 880 MHz. It has 1536 shading units. The thermal design power (TDP) is 250W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 615 points. Launch price was $369.

Radeon R6 M255DX
The Radeon R6 M255DX is manufactured by AMD. It was released in June 4 2014. It features the GCN architecture. It has 896 shading units. The thermal design power (TDP) is 30W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 605 points.
Graphics Performance
The Radeon HD 5600/5700 scores 615 and the Radeon R6 M255DX reaches 605 in the G3D Mark benchmark — just a 1.7% difference, making them near-identical in rasterization performance. The Radeon HD 5600/5700 is built on TeraScale 3 while the Radeon R6 M255DX uses GCN, both on 40 nm vs 28 nm. Shader units: 1,536 (Radeon HD 5600/5700) vs 896 (Radeon R6 M255DX).
